Intraputaminal Delivery of Adeno‐Associated Virus Serotype 2–Glial Cell Line–Derived Neurotrophic Factor in Mild or Moderate Parkinson's Disease

open access: yesMovement Disorders, EarlyView.
Abstract Background Glial cell line–derived neurotrophic factor (GDNF) is required for development and survival of dopaminergic neurons. A previous trial evaluating lower‐dose adeno‐associated virus serotype 2–GDNF (AAV2‐GDNF) bilateral intraputaminal infusion in participants with advanced Parkinson's disease (PD) achieved 26% mean putaminal coverage ...

Cholinergic System Changes in Dopa‐Unresponsive Freezing of Gait in Parkinson's Disease

open access: yesMovement Disorders, EarlyView.
Abstract Background Freezing of gait (FoG) is a debilitating mobility disturbance that becomes increasingly resistant to dopaminergic pharmacotherapies with advancing Parkinson's disease (PD). The pathophysiology underlying the response of FoG to dopaminergic treatment is poorly understood.
